Inhaltsverzeichnis
Situational awareness, sensemaking, and situation understanding in cyber warfare.- Neuromorphic Computing for Cognitive Augmentation in Cyber Defense.- Automated Cyber Situation Awareness Tools and Models for Improving Analyst Performance.- Data Mining in Cyber Operations.- Trusted Computation through Biologically Inspired Processes.- Dynamic Logic Machine Learning for Cybersecurity.- Towards Neural Network Based Malware Detection on Android Mobile Devices.- Sustainability Problems and a Novelty in the Concept of Energy.- Memristors as Synapses in Artificial Neural Networks: Biomimicry Beyond Weight Change.- Low Power Neuromorphic Architectures to Enable Pervasive Deployment of Intrusion Detection Systems.- Memristor SPICE Model Simulation and Device Hardware Correlation.- Reconfigurable Memristor Based Computing Logic.- Cyber Security Considerations for Reconfigurable Systems.
